Knopf, 1974, 1974. Book. Near Fine. Hardcover. First American Edition / First Printing. Small Octavo. 256 pp + iv, statde First American Edition (t.p. verso), a novel, about the author, about the translator, a note on type. 5.9" x 8.6" off-white cloth boards, blue lettering & design, in unclipped illustrated DJ with acetate protector. Binding tight and square, board forecorners very slight bumped tips, pages clean and unmarked, paper well-preserved. .

- Tight
-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
